Raider Recap 11-14-15

BoysWell as I said today was a very busy day in Raider Nation as two Raider teams (Volleyball and Boys Soccer) competed for sectional titles while football played host to Quincy on senior day. Could they get a win heading into thanksgiving and would there be some sectional hardware coming home to Wellesley, let’s find out.

Results for 11-14-15

Boys Soccer: Brockton 4 Wellesley 0 MIAA D1 South Final

The boys finish their season with an 11-6-3 record, congratulations on a tremendous season and best of luck to the seniors going forward.

Girls Volleyball: Concord Carlisle 3 Wellesley 1 MIAA D1 Central/West Final

The girls finish with an 18-3 record, congratulations on an awesome season and also best of luck to the seniors.

Football: Quincy 6 Wellesley 0

Girls Swimming: Finished 5th at the South Sectionals at MIT. Lily Gribbel finish in first in the 50 and 100 fly events.

Boys Cross Country: Took first place in Division 2 at Eastern Mass Championships

Girls Cross Country: Finished in 5th place in Division 2 at Eastern Mass Championships

That being said I do have the Raider trivia Friday answer and it is… Acton Boxborough. That’s right the Wellesley South Little Leaguers captured the towns first little league state title with a 4-3 walk off win vs AB back in 2012, the team would then go on to the regionals in Bristol Connecticut where they would advance to the semifinals before falling to New Hampshire.
